Eitan Seri- Levi
c0ee0d54fe
merge
2026-03-02 13:05:13 -08:00
Eitan Seri- Levi
a937802dc3
dont make pub
2026-03-02 12:31:31 -08:00
Eitan Seri-Levi
9a8bedf76d
Update beacon_node/beacon_chain/src/metrics.rs
...
Co-authored-by: Jimmy Chen <jchen.tc@gmail.com >
2026-03-03 05:27:24 +09:00
Eitan Seri- Levi
c48594fe18
YAY
2026-02-26 18:19:19 -08:00
Eitan Seri- Levi
8dbab49286
Resolve merge conflicts
2026-02-26 13:19:00 -08:00
Michael Sproul
30f8cab182
Fixes to test relying on cold DB
2026-02-26 21:38:57 +11:00
Eitan Seri- Levi
76109327bc
address changes
2026-02-25 23:45:42 -08:00
Michael Sproul
e44f37895d
Simplify diff strat and expand tests (they mostly pass!)
2026-02-26 17:15:32 +11:00
Eitan Seri- Levi
afbba87a64
Fix comments
2026-02-25 22:04:35 -08:00
Michael Sproul
edf77a5298
Small fixes relating to genesis
2026-02-26 10:20:47 +11:00
Eitan Seri- Levi
ffb6f296bd
temp
2026-02-25 14:56:30 -08:00
Eitan Seri- Levi
d370461dab
Merge branch 'unstable' of https://github.com/sigp/lighthouse into gloas-payload-processing
2026-02-25 09:06:07 -08:00
Eitan Seri- Levi
12eddb561c
fix new payload notifier
2026-02-24 22:49:57 -08:00
Michael Sproul
adfa3b882d
First Gloas test passes!
2026-02-25 17:09:32 +11:00
Michael Sproul
59a2b6dead
Fix state for block production
2026-02-25 16:02:15 +11:00
Michael Sproul
57527e5094
Fix load_parent
2026-02-25 14:26:21 +11:00
Lion - dapplion
d6bf53834f
Remove merge transition code ( #8761 )
...
Co-Authored-By: dapplion <35266934+dapplion@users.noreply.github.com >
2026-02-25 03:20:28 +00:00
Michael Sproul
984f0d70e0
Make state cache payload status aware
2026-02-25 13:21:48 +11:00
Michael Sproul
a09839df1f
Merge remote-tracking branch 'eitan/gloas-payload-processing' into gloas-replay-blocks
2026-02-25 12:05:30 +11:00
Michael Sproul
f4b7f8f02d
Fixed signed envelopes etc
2026-02-25 10:53:41 +11:00
Michael Sproul
fe240ba892
Start updating the test harness (Claude)
2026-02-25 10:15:54 +11:00
Jimmy Chen
e59f1f03ef
Add debug spans to DB write paths ( #8895 )
...
Co-Authored-By: Jimmy Chen <jchen.tc@gmail.com >
2026-02-24 20:53:33 +00:00
Eitan Seri- Levi
38ef0d07e5
Update TODO
2026-02-24 12:17:12 -08:00
Eitan Seri- Levi
0761da770d
Clean up comments
2026-02-24 12:15:52 -08:00
Eitan Seri- Levi
876e6899cd
Some more TODOs
2026-02-24 12:14:30 -08:00
Eitan Seri- Levi
2093dc1f39
move execution pending envelolpe logic to its own file
2026-02-24 12:08:07 -08:00
Eitan Seri- Levi
30241f54c4
add load_snapshot_from_state_root that can be used when we've already aquired a
2026-02-24 11:35:01 -08:00
Eitan Seri- Levi
fc7d6c9d24
Add an additional defensive expected proposer check
2026-02-24 11:20:07 -08:00
Eitan Seri- Levi
147f2e22e0
use cached head and drop fork choice read lock earlier
2026-02-24 10:59:03 -08:00
Eitan Seri- Levi
6e89ba63be
Added slot to logs
2026-02-24 10:51:09 -08:00
Eitan Seri- Levi
1d3b5776a4
Merge branch 'unstable' of https://github.com/sigp/lighthouse into gloas-payload-processing
2026-02-24 10:47:12 -08:00
Eitan Seri- Levi
8ce81578b7
introduce a smalll refactor and unit test
2026-02-24 10:46:46 -08:00
Michael Sproul
e2b3971cbd
Add StatePayloadStatus to storage_strategy
2026-02-24 17:48:28 +11:00
Michael Sproul
886d31fe7e
Delete dysfunctional fork_revert feature ( #8891 )
...
I found myself having to update this code for Gloas, and figured we may as well delete it seeing as it doesn't work.
See:
- https://github.com/sigp/lighthouse/issues/4198
Delete all `fork_revert` logic and the accompanying test.
Co-Authored-By: Michael Sproul <michael@sigmaprime.io >
2026-02-24 06:27:16 +00:00
Michael Sproul
c22dde11f8
Merge remote-tracking branch 'michael/delete-fork-revert' into gloas-replay-blocks
2026-02-24 15:35:14 +11:00
Michael Sproul
295aaf982c
Thread more payload status
2026-02-24 15:33:43 +11:00
Michael Sproul
adc0498057
Delete fork_revert feature
2026-02-24 15:23:54 +11:00
Eitan Seri- Levi
d12bb4d712
Trying something out
2026-02-23 12:06:15 -08:00
Michael Sproul
9bdf44c76c
Merge branch 'unstable' into gloas-replay-blocks
2026-02-23 17:29:13 +11:00
Eitan Seri-Levi
dcc43e3d20
Implement gloas block gossip verification changes ( #8878 )
...
Co-Authored-By: Eitan Seri-Levi <eserilev@ucsc.edu >
Co-Authored-By: Eitan Seri- Levi <eserilev@gmail.com >
Co-Authored-By: Michael Sproul <michaelsproul@users.noreply.github.com >
2026-02-23 06:17:24 +00:00
Michael Sproul
afc6fb137c
Connect up DB replay_blocks/load_blocks
2026-02-23 15:43:19 +11:00
Michael Sproul
a959c5f640
Add payload support to BlockReplayer
2026-02-23 12:55:50 +11:00
Eitan Seri- Levi
b525fe055f
Fix
2026-02-22 16:07:48 -08:00
Eitan Seri- Levi
de2362a820
Fix compilation error
2026-02-22 10:17:47 -08:00
Eitan Seri- Levi
1859bc25a4
Merge branch 'unstable' of https://github.com/sigp/lighthouse into gloas-payload-processing
2026-02-20 10:39:29 -08:00
Michael Sproul
fab77f4fc9
Skip payload_invalidation tests prior to Bellatrix ( #8856 )
...
Fix the failure of the beacon-chain tests for phase0/altair, which now only runs nightly.
Just skip the payload invalidation tests, they don't make any sense prior to Bellatrix anyway.
Co-Authored-By: Michael Sproul <michael@sigmaprime.io >
2026-02-18 21:55:13 +00:00
Eitan Seri-Levi
1bd941e0df
Merge branch 'gloas-payload-processing' into gloas-devnet-0
2026-02-17 21:27:57 -08:00
Eitan Seri-Levi
0b58cbf2d2
mark block as avail as soon as call to el succeeds
2026-02-17 21:27:44 -08:00
Eitan Seri-Levi
d88f0f7b4c
resolve merge conflicts
2026-02-17 18:10:22 -08:00
Eitan Seri-Levi
81d30d576a
FMT
2026-02-17 17:47:34 -08:00